Little Barachois River
Little Barachois River is a stream in Newfoundland and Labrador, Atlantic Canada. Little Barachois River is situated nearby to the locality Little Barasway, as well as near Great Barasway.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Placentia is a town of 3,500 people on the west side of Newfoundland's Avalon Peninsula. It was the French capital of Newfoundland in the early 17th century.
